About the Role
We are seeking a highly motivated Senior Specialist, Drug Safety to support and ensure compliance with Pharmacovigilance (PV) and Medical Device Vigilance (MV) requirements across our Healthcare business. This role plays a key part in safeguarding patient safety, maintaining regulatory compliance, and supporting clients through effective safety surveillance and reporting activities.
General Responsibilities:
- Implement and maintain Pharmacovigilance (PV) and Medical Device Vigilance (MV) policies, strategies, and objectives in compliance with company and client requirements.
- Ensure compliance with PV/MV obligations as outlined in Safety Data Exchange Agreements (SDEAs), Medical Device Vigilance Agreements (MDVAs), quality documents, and local regulatory requirements.
- Ensure the timely processing and reporting of adverse events to clients and/or health authorities.
- Conduct literature surveillance and identify potential safety signals or emerging safety concerns.
- Support the implementation and monitoring of risk management plans, educational programs, and risk minimization measures.
- Collaborate with clients and Regulatory Affairs on periodic safety reporting and responses to safety-related enquiries.
- Monitor PV/MV compliance metrics, perform reconciliation activities, and ensure adherence to safety agreements and contractual obligations.
- Develop and deliver PV/MV training programs and maintain accurate, inspection-ready training records.
- Support internal audits, client audits, regulatory inspections, and the implementation of corrective and preventive actions (CAPAs).
- Act as the local PV/MV contact for clients and stakeholders, providing compliance reports, safety updates, and ongoing operational support.
